Principles applicable to the processing of personal data

The processing of the User’s personal data shall be subject to the following principles set out in Article 5 of the GDPR and in Article 4 et seq. of the Organic Law 3/2018 of 5 December on the Protection of Personal Data and guarantee of digital rights:

    • Principle of lawfulness, fairness and transparency: the consent of the User will be required at all times after fully transparent information of the purposes for which personal data is collected.
    • Principle of purpose limitation: personal data will be collected for specified, explicit and legitimate purposes.
  • Principle of data minimization: the personal data collected will be only those strictly necessary in relation to the purposes for which they are processed.
  • Accuracy principle: personal data must be accurate and always up to date.
  • Principle of limitation of the storage period: personal data shall only be kept in such a way as to allow the identification of the User for the time necessary for the purposes of their processing.
  • Principle of integrity and confidentiality: personal data will be processed in such a way as to ensure their security and confidentiality.
  • Principle of proactive responsibility: the Controller shall be responsible for ensuring that the above principles are complied with.

Special categories of personal data are understood as data revealing racial or ethnic origin, political opinions, religious or philosophical beliefs, or trade union membership, and the processing of genetic data, biometric data aimed at uniquely identifying a natural person, data concerning health or data concerning the sex life or sexual orientation of a natural person.

For the processing of special categories of personal data, the explicit consent of the User for one or more specific purposes will be required in any case.

Rights arising from the processing of personal data

The User has over Somepharm Iberia and may, therefore, exercise against the Data Controller the following rights recognized in the GDPR and the Organic Law 3/2018 of 5 December on Personal Data Protection and Guarantee of Digital Rights:

  • Right of access: The User has the right to obtain confirmation as to whether or not Somepharm Iberia is processing their personal data and, if so, to obtain information about their specific personal data and the treatment that Somepharm Iberia has carried out or carries out, as well as, inter alia, the information available on the origin of such data and the recipients of communications made or planned thereof.
  • Right of rectification: The User has the right to have their personal data amended if it is inaccurate or, taking into account the purposes for which they are processed, incomplete.
  • Right to deletion (“the right to be forgotten”): It is the User’s right, unless applicable law provides otherwise, to have their personal data deleted when they are no longer necessary for the purposes for which they were collected or processed; the User has withdrawn his consent to the processing and this does not have another legal basis; the User opposes the processing and there is no other legitimate reason to continue with it; the personal data has been processed unlawfully; the personal data must be deleted in compliance with a legal obligation; or the personal data have been obtained from a direct offer of information society services to a child under 14 years of age. In addition to deleting the data, the Controller, taking into account the available technology and the cost of its application, shall take reasonable steps to inform the controllers processing the personal data of the data subject’s request for deletion of any link to those personal data.
  • Right to restriction of processing: It is the User’s right to limit the processing of their personal data. The User has the right to obtain the limitation of processing when he disputes the accuracy of his personal data; the processing is unlawful; the Controller no longer needs the personal data, but the User needs it to make claims; and when the User has objected to the processing.
  • Right to data portability: In the event that processing is carried out by automated means, the User shall have the right to receive his personal data from the Controller in a structured format, commonly used and machine-readable, and to transmit them to another controller. Where technically possible, the Data Controller shall transmit the data directly to that other controller.
  • Right of opposition: The User has the right to have their personal data not processed or to have their processing stopped by Somepharm Iberia.
  • Right not to be subject to a decision based solely on automated processing, including profiling: It is the User’s right not to be subject to an individual decision based solely on automated processing of their personal data, the development of existing profiles, unless the legislation in force provides otherwise.

Access to this Website may involve the use of cookies. Cookies are small amounts of information that are stored in the browser used by each User -on the different devices you can use to browse- so that the server remembers certain information that later and only the server that implemented it will read. Cookies make navigation easier, more user-friendly, and do not damage the browsing device.

Cookies are automatic procedures for collecting information about the preferences determined by the User during his visit to the Website in order to recognize him as a User, and personalize his experience and use of the Website, and may also, for example, Help identify and resolve errors.

Information collected through cookies may include the date and time of visits to the Website, pages viewed, time spent on the Website, and sites visited just before and after the Website. However, no cookie allows it to be contacted with the User’s phone number or any other means of personal contact. No cookie can extract information from the User’s hard drive or steal personal information. The only way that User’s private information is part of the Cookie file is if the User personally gives that information to the server.
